Figure 2.

Results of the AFM and live cell imaging measurements for the 3 glioblastoma cell lines. (A) Shows the mean measured Young´s modulus with standard error of the mean (SEM) for each cell line and treatment. Statistical significance was achieved for treatments of U138 (nCTL = 60; nJWH-133 = 40; nACEA = 40) cells only. U87 (nCTL = 60; nJWH-133 = 60; nACEA = 40) and LN229 (nCTL = 60; nJWH-133 = 40; nACEA = 40) cells did not show a change in elasticity. No receptor/agonist specific effect could be observed. (B) Calculated mean adhesion energies to the cantilever via the DMT model. All treatments resulted in a decrease of the adhesiveness for all cell lines, except for U87 treated with ACEA. The numbers of analyzed cells used for determination of adhesion energy were identical to those for the Young´s modulus. (C) Derived speeds (mean ± SEM) from the time lapse images. One can observe diverse significant effects on the measured speed, with no apparent receptor/agonist specificity (U138: nCTL = 67, nJWH-133 = 81, nACEA = 78. For LN229: nCTL = 118, nJWH-133 = 177, nACEA = 57. For U87: nCTL = 158, nJWH-133 = 230, nACEA = 93.). (D) Mean area and SEM of each cell line treated with cannabinoids or as control measurement. The CB2 agonist led to a decrease of the area for U87 and LN229 cells but had no effect on the U138 cells. The CB1 agonist only resulted in a decrease of area for the U87 cells. No receptor/agonist specificity that holds for all cells could be observed. The numbers of experimental values for the cell area were identical to the ones for the cell speed. Statistics was performed using the Mann-Whitney test and significance was chosen for p < 0.05. The asterisk denotes significant results regarding the control measurement of the same cell line.
